Fried Potatoes, Onions, and Smoked Polish Sausage

A delightful comfort food dish combining crispy potatoes, sweet onions, and smoky Polish sausage, perfect for any night of the week.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Servings: 4 servings
Course: Dinner, Main Course
Cuisine: American
Calories: 350

Ingredients
  

Main Ingredients
  • 2 medium medium-sized potatoes, diced into small cubes Opt for starchy potatoes like Russets for the crispiest results.
  • 1 large large onion, sliced (preferably yellow or white)
  • 1 pound smoked Polish sausage, sliced into rounds Ensure the sausage is free of any products if needed.
  • 2 tablespoons vegetable oil (or your choice of cooking oil)
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Optional: chopped parsley for garnish

Method
 

Preparation
  1. Wash and dice the potatoes into small cubes. Slice the onion and the smoked Polish sausage into manageable pieces.
Cooking
  1. In a large skillet or frying pan, heat the vegetable oil over medium heat.
  2. Add the sliced smoked sausage to the hot oil and sauté for about 5-7 minutes until it starts to brown.
  3. Toss in the sliced onions with the sausage. Stir them together frequently until the onions turn translucent, about 3-4 minutes.
  4. Add the diced potatoes to the skillet, and season them with salt and pepper. Stir everything to combine well.
  5. Reduce the heat to medium-low, cover the skillet, and let it cook for about 15-20 minutes, stirring occasionally to prevent sticking. The potatoes should be tender and golden by the end of this cooking phase.
  6. Taste and adjust the seasoning if needed. Serve it warm, garnished with chopped parsley if desired.

Notes

Tip: Don't rush the cooking process and allow the sausage and onions to brown properly to deepen the flavor.
